网站日志格式突变别慌,高效分析处理攻略来啦

作者: 广州SEO
发布时间: 2025年10月06日 10:44:28

在网站运维的漫长旅程中,日志分析是洞察网站健康状况的“显微镜”。但当日志格式突然“变脸”,你是否会感到手足无措?我深知,面对突如其来的格式变化,高效分析处理是关键。今天,就让我带你揭开高效应对日志格式突变的神秘面纱。

一、日志格式突变,为何要重视?

日志格式突变,犹如一场突如其来的“风暴”,可能让原本顺畅的分析流程陷入混乱。它不仅影响数据的准确性,还可能掩盖潜在的问题。我曾亲历一次日志格式突变,导致关键指标分析失误,险些酿成大祸。因此,重视并高效处理日志格式突变,是网站运维的必修课。

1、突变带来的挑战

日志格式突变,最直接的影响是数据解析的困难。原有的解析规则可能失效,导致数据无法正确提取。这就像一把钥匙突然打不开锁,让人焦急万分。

2、对分析流程的影响

格式突变还可能打乱整个分析流程。从数据收集、清洗到分析,每一步都可能因格式变化而受阻。这种“蝴蝶效应”可能导致分析结果的大幅偏差。

3、实操中的应对策略

面对日志格式突变,我通常会先备份原始日志,防止数据丢失。然后,快速定位格式变化的具体位置,调整解析规则。这一过程中,保持冷静和耐心至关重要。

二、高效分析处理,如何做到?

高效分析处理日志格式突变,需要一套系统的方法论。它不仅要求技术过硬,还需要对日志数据有深入的理解。我结合多年实操经验,总结出一套高效分析处理攻略。

1、解析规则的灵活调整

面对格式突变,解析规则的调整是关键。我通常会先分析新格式的特点,然后针对性地修改解析脚本。这就像为一把新锁配一把新钥匙,需要精准和细致。

2、利用工具提升效率

在处理日志格式突变时,工具的选择至关重要。我偏爱使用那些支持自定义解析规则的工具,它们能大大提升处理效率。同时,自动化工具也是我的得力助手,它们能减少人为错误,提高分析准确性。

3、案例分析:成功应对突变

我曾遇到过一次日志格式的大幅突变,导致原有解析脚本完全失效。我迅速调整策略,利用正则表达式重新编写解析规则,并结合自动化工具进行批量处理。最终,成功恢复了数据分析的流畅性。

4、数据清洗与预处理的重要性

在日志分析中,数据清洗与预处理同样重要。面对格式突变带来的脏数据,我会通过编写清洗脚本,过滤掉无效和错误的数据。这一过程就像给数据“洗澡”,让它们焕然一新。

三、预防与应对,如何双管齐下?

预防日志格式突变,比事后应对更为重要。我总结出一套预防与应对相结合的策略,帮助你在日志分析中游刃有余。

1、日志格式的标准化建议

预防日志格式突变,首先要从源头抓起。我建议网站在生成日志时,尽量采用标准化的格式。这就像制定一套统一的“语言规则”,让数据更容易被理解和处理。

2、监控与预警机制的建立

建立监控与预警机制,是预防日志格式突变的有效手段。我通常会设置日志格式变化的监控规则,一旦检测到异常,立即触发预警。这就像给网站装上一个“警报器”,时刻守护着日志的安全。

3、与开发团队的沟通协作

面对日志格式突变,与开发团队的沟通协作至关重要。我通常会与开发团队保持密切联系,及时了解日志格式的变化情况。同时,我也会向开发团队反馈分析需求,共同优化日志格式。

4、持续学习与技能提升

在日志分析领域,持续学习与技能提升是永恒的主题。我经常会参加各种技术交流和培训活动,不断更新自己的知识库。这就像给大脑“充电”,让自己始终保持在行业的前沿。

四、相关问题

1、问题:日志格式突变后,如何快速定位问题所在?

答:我会先对比新旧日志格式,找出差异点。然后,通过编写测试脚本,验证解析规则是否失效。最后,结合日志内容,分析格式突变可能带来的影响。

2、问题:面对复杂的日志格式突变,如何保持分析效率?

答:我会利用自动化工具进行批量处理,减少人为操作。同时,我会优化解析脚本,提高解析效率。此外,我还会与团队成员分享经验,共同应对挑战。

3、问题:日志格式突变后,如何确保数据分析的准确性?

答:我会对清洗后的数据进行二次验证,确保数据的准确性。同时,我会结合其他数据源进行交叉验证,提高分析结果的可靠性。此外,我还会定期回顾分析结果,及时发现并纠正错误。

4、问题:如何预防日志格式突变带来的风险?

答:我会建议网站采用标准化的日志格式,减少格式变化的可能性。同时,我会建立监控与预警机制,及时发现并处理格式突变。此外,我还会与开发团队保持密切沟通,共同优化日志生成和处理流程。

五、总结

面对网站日志格式突变,我们无需恐慌。通过灵活调整解析规则、利用工具提升效率、建立监控与预警机制以及持续学习与技能提升,我们完全能够高效应对这一挑战。记住,每一次突变都是一次成长的机会,让我们携手共进,在日志分析的道路上越走越远。正所谓“兵来将挡,水来土掩”,只要我们准备充分,就没有克服不了的困难。